Professor Arnold E. Ross founded his program for high school students in 1957 at the University of Notre Dame. The program moved with him to Ohio State in 1964, and he continued to run it every summer until 2000. Dr Ross died on September 25, 2002 at the age of 96. The Fiftieth Anniversary of the Ross Program (1957 - 2007) was celebrated at a Reunion-Conference in Columbus on July 20 - 22, 2007.

Previous Ross Program Reunion-Conferences were held in 1996 and in 2001.
